You should dispute it (seems Jessi forgot to sign in, lol). One account cannot be reported by multiple creditors and collection agencies. Dispute it with bureaus. Hopefully they will remove this entry after running an investigation.

Since you are paying to Midland for this debt, you need not worry any more. Keep the records of your payment and ask them to update your credit file once it is paid in full. Keep us posted.
